Community Education - Minneapolis Public Schools - Community Education
Helps people develop skills and knowledge to improve their lives and communities. Offers a variety of programs for learners of all ages. Class offerings include adult enrichment classes, arts and craft classes, computer classes, cooking classes, defensive driving courses, field trips, gardening lessons, health and fitness, Life, Learning, and Culture courses, sports and recreational activities, swimming lessons, youth enrichment activities, and more.

Fee
Individuals that may receive a discounted fee: - Seniors 62 or older, 25% discount - Social Security recipients, 25% discount - Unemployment recipients, 25% discount - MFIP recipients, 25% discount - Class supply fees are not discounted - UCare members with eligible plans can use their Healthy Benefits Visa to pay for classes - Note: To receive a discount on a class, call the site offering the class -$5 cancelation fee for adult classes. $15 cancelation fee for summer youth classes.
